Best Time to Visit Dubai on a Budget
Timing plays a big role in saving money. The cheapest months to visit Dubai are June to August due to extreme heat.
However, if you want pleasant weather and deals, April and September are ideal. Hotel prices drop, and flight discounts are easier to find.

Budget Hotels and Stay Options
Dubai offers many budget-friendly accommodations. Areas like Deira, Bur Dubai, and Al Barsha are great for saving money.
You can also choose:
3-star hotels
Hostels
Serviced apartments
These options provide comfort without luxury pricing.
Cheap Transportation in Dubai
Dubai’s public transport system is clean, safe, and affordable. The Dubai Metro connects major tourist spots.
To save more:
Buy a Nol Card
Use buses and metro instead of taxis
Walk in nearby areas when possible
This keeps daily travel costs low.

Free and Low-Cost Attractions
Dubai has many attractions that are free or very affordable.
Some popular options include:
JBR Beach
Dubai Fountain Show
Al Fahidi Historical District
Public beaches and markets
These places offer great experiences without ticket costs.
Sample Budget Breakdown for Dubai Trip
Below is a simple budget estimate for a 5-day Dubai budget friendly trip in 2026:
| Expense Category | Approx Cost (INR) |
|---|---|
| Flights (Return) | ₹25,000 – ₹30,000 |
| Visa | ₹6,000 – ₹7,000 |
| Hotel (4 nights) | ₹12,000 – ₹15,000 |
| Food | ₹5,000 – ₹6,000 |
| Transport | ₹2,000 – ₹3,000 |
| Attractions | ₹3,000 – ₹4,000 |
This table helps you plan expenses realistically.
